Hotel Description
Located on Hutt Street a vibrant tree lined boulevard within the city center. The Adelaide Travelers Inn Backpackers Hostel offers some off street as well as local free on street parking. Facilities at Adelaide Travelers Inn Backpackers Hostel include a communal kitchen and a shared lounge room with cable TV. Passport identification is required for all bookings. Guests can choose from a range of private rooms and dormitory style rooms with Ensuite private rooms and shared rooms with share bathrooms. Most dorm rooms have 4 beds with female only male only and mixed. The tree lined location on Hutt Street gives easy access to local cafe's restaurants shops hotels and then it's a short walk to a fitness circuit within Adelaide Parklands. A FREE city circuit bus operates regularly nearby to give you access to the whole CBD. St Andrew's Hospital and the Wakefield Hospital are both within a 5-minute walk. City free bus stop is nearby and circles the city every 15 minutes' during the day. If traveling to the airport just hop on the Free City Connector bus (Clockwise) and change to Bus J1 (Glenelg) at Bus Stop W1. The J1 bus will take you straight to the Adelaide Airport Bus Stop 10.

Check-in time: 12:00   Check-out time: 10:00

Rahul Tue, 22 April 2025

Great people, great vibe, nothing...

Liked: The place was a vibe. Great to meet people, and the staff for the most part are really lovely and go out their way to help you. Also in a great location!
Disliked: There was 3 showers & 3 toilets & a tiny kitchen for 50 people. If you book a private room with a shared bathroom, you're right on the public balcony where people can be up drinking till 7am, or up to start drinking at 11am. The air conditioning couldn't be turned off in my room and sounded like a vaccum cleaner.The wifi simply did not work, nor extend to my room which as a digital nomad created a bit of chaos in my life as I had to find accomodation with wifi for meetings for work (I live in the UK, so those meetings were often after 11pm). After asking politely if they could move further down the balcony, one guy really kicked off with me. Was pretty raging to find out later in my stay he was a staff member who was staying in the private quiet zone.If it wasn't for the fact every other staff member was lush, and the people in the hostel were for the most part great, I would have given this a rating of 1.
